3-Methyl and 3,3-dimethyl analogs of 2-(2,4-difluorophenyl)-3-(omega-substituted alkyl)sulfonyl-1-(1H-1,2,4-triazol-1-yl)-2-propanols were synthesized and evaluated for their antifungal activities against Candida albicans and Aspergillus fumigatus. The 3,3-dimethyl analogs were found to have more potent activity both in vitro and in vivo than the corresponding 3-mono-methyl analogs. The prophylactic efficacy of the lead compounds against murine systemic candidiasis and aspergillosis was improved significantly by dimethylation of the 3-position.
